What do you like about working at Black Ops Entertainment?
"The atmosphere was great. You weren't ever too stressed, but at the same time, people were dedicated to working hard and getting everything done. Not constantly being hounded by your bosses frees you up mentally to be more creative, and also gives you the freedom to implement systems and algorithms properly. It's a good balance."
Do you have any tips for others interviewing with this company?
"They're cool guys, so don't feel too pressured. They're not going to bite your head off if you say something they don't agree with. Just go in there with a good attitude and know your stuff. If you're a good candidate, you'll do just fine."
What don't you like about working at Black Ops Entertainment?
"I guess the biggest thing that bothered me was the lack of passion from co-workers. Too many people treated their time there as just a job. I suppose that isn't the worst thing in the world, but certainly it would be nice to see some more energy from people there."
What suggestions do you have for management?
"They all did a great job, so I don't have much to suggest other than to keep up the great work!"
